Hexstring
A safe-to-use OCaml library to encode/decode hexadecimal strings.
Install with opam:
opam install hexstring
Add to your dune file:
(libraries hexstring)
Use as such:
(* you can encode bytes to an hexstring *)
b = Bytes.of_string "\x01\x02";;
s = Hexstring.encode b;; (* "0102" *)
(* you can also decode some hexstring, which returns a result of bytes *)
d = match Hexstring.decode s with
| Error err -> printf "error: %s\n"
| Ok b' -> assert b = b'
Since it returns a Result
type, it's on the caller to decide what to do with an invalid input. No functions will panic on you.
